**What are Zinc Plated Wheel Bolts and Nuts?**
Zinc plated wheel bolts and nuts are essential fasteners used in various industrial applications. These components are coated with a layer of zinc to provide corrosion resistance and enhance durability. The zinc plating not only protects the bolts and nuts from rust and corrosion but also improves their overall performance and longevity.
**Benefits of Zinc Plated Wheel Bolts and Nuts**
1. **Corrosion Resistance**: One of the main advantages of zinc plated wheel bolts and nuts is their excellent corrosion resistance. The zinc coating acts as a barrier, preventing moisture and other corrosive elements from reaching the metal surface, thus prolonging the lifespan of the fasteners.
2. **Enhanced Durability**: The zinc plating not only protects the bolts and nuts from corrosion but also provides an extra layer of protection against wear and tear. This helps extend the life of the components and reduces the need for frequent replacements.

**Applications of Zinc Plated Wheel Bolts and Nuts**
Zinc plated wheel bolts and nuts are widely used in various industrial sectors, including automotive, construction, manufacturing, and more. These components are essential for securing wheels, axles, and other critical parts in machinery and equipment.
